
Sofimac Innovation
Description
Sofimac Innovation, formerly known as iSource Gestion, is a prominent French venture capital firm specializing in early-stage investments. Operating as a key entity within the broader Sofimac Partners group, the firm has established itself as a significant player in the French technology and innovation ecosystem. Its strategic focus lies in identifying and nurturing high-potential startups from their nascent stages, providing crucial capital and strategic guidance to facilitate growth.
The firm's investment thesis is primarily centered on disruptive technologies and innovative business models across several key sectors. Sofimac Innovation actively targets opportunities in Digital, Health, Industry, and Deeptech, reflecting a commitment to areas poised for significant transformation. Geographically, its operations are concentrated within France, with a strong presence in Paris and other dynamic regional tech hubs, underscoring its dedication to fostering domestic innovation.
Sofimac Innovation typically deploys initial capital ranging from €100,000 to €3 million in its portfolio companies. This initial commitment is often followed by subsequent investments, demonstrating the firm's capacity and willingness to support its ventures through multiple funding rounds as they scale. As part of Sofimac Partners, the group collectively manages over €500 million in assets under management, providing a robust financial foundation for its investment activities and enabling substantial follow-on capacity.
With a history rooted in iSource Gestion, Sofimac Innovation leverages extensive experience and a deep network to assist its portfolio companies beyond mere capital injection. The firm emphasizes a collaborative approach, working closely with founders to navigate challenges, accelerate market entry, and achieve sustainable growth. Their long-term commitment to supporting innovative French enterprises solidifies their reputation as a pivotal partner for early-stage tech ventures.
Investor Profile
Sofimac Innovation has backed more than 20 startups, with 0 new investments in the last 12 months alone. The firm has led 4 rounds, about 20% of its total and boasts 4 exits across its portfolio.
Investment Focus Highlights
- Concentrates on Series A, Series Unknown, Series B rounds (top funding stages).
- Majority of deals are located in France, The Netherlands, United States.
- Strong thematic focus on Software, Health Care, Biotechnology.
- Typical check size: $108K – $3.2M.
Stage Focus
- Series A (35%)
- Series Unknown (30%)
- Series B (15%)
- Seed (15%)
- Private Equity (5%)
Country Focus
- France (90%)
- The Netherlands (5%)
- United States (5%)
Industry Focus
- Software
- Health Care
- Biotechnology
- Medical Device
- Electronics
- Information Technology
- Manufacturing
- Semiconductor
- Pharmaceutical
- Industrial Engineering
Frequently Asked Questions
Learn who this investor regularly partners with—both firms and angels—and explore their latest activity.